Abstract

The invention relates to a bladder drainage medicine perfusion device. A urethral catheter is a three-chamber catheter provided with a urination drainage chamber, a water injection chamber and a medicine perfusion chamber, wherein the three chambers of the urethral catheter are respectively independent; the urination drainage chamber is positioned in the center of the urethral catheter, the upper end of the urethral catheter is closed, the side wall on the upper end is provided with a drainage port which is communicated with the urination drainage chamber, and the end surface of the lower end of the urethral catheter is provided with an outlet of the urination drainage chamber which is communicated with a urine drainage bag; the water injection chamber and the medicine perfusion chamber are respectively arranged in the side wall of the urethral catheter; a water injection port on the upper end of the water injection chamber is communicated with a positioning sac, a water injection hole on the lower end of the water injection chamber is connected with a water injection interface, and the water injection interface is provided with a switch; and a medicine perfusion port on the upper end of the medicine perfusion chamber extends through the side wall of the urethral catheter, a medicine perfusion hole on the lower end of the medicine perfusion chamber is connected with a medicine perfusion interface, the medicine perfusion interface is connected with a medicine perfusion pump capable of adjusing the flow rate through a catheter, and one end of the medicine perfusion pump is connected with a medicine tank. The bladder drainage medicine perfusion device is simple in structure and convenient to use, has a urethral catheterization function, and can continuously and slowly perfuse medicine into the bladder as required.

Background technology
Irrigation of bladder is the interior topical medications method of bladder cavity commonly used clinically; Be mainly used in the postoperative chemoprophylaxis of tumor of bladder, the aspects such as irrigation of cystitis; Its method that adopts usually is the medicine of dilution to be passed through the disposable injection patient's of catheter intravesical, and medicine was kept 0.5~2 hour at intravesical.But adopt the weak point of this method to be, because medicine makes medicine in filling process, not possess persistence through the disposable injection patient's of catheter intravesical; Receive the restriction of patient's bladder capacity; Can medicine be excreted in a short time, shorten medicine in intravesical retention time, especially for patients such as interstitial cystitiss; More maybe because of the time of contact of mucous membrane of urinary bladder and medicine the too short drug effect that causes insufficient, thereby affect the treatment and cause the waste of medicine; Simultaneously because medicine passes through the disposable injection patient's of catheter intravesical; Make drug level high; In the preventative perfusion chemotherapy of bladder cancer, the high concentration chemotherapeutics is bigger to bladder irritation like this, possibly cause that mucous membrane of urinary bladder burns; Form chemical cystitis, symptoms such as frequent micturition, urgent micturition, dysurea and hematuria occur.
Summary of the invention
The objective of the invention is deficiency to prior art; A kind of bladder drainage drug infusion device is provided; It is simple in structure, and is easy to use, has both had the urethral catheterization function; Can continue as required again slowly to the intravesical dabbling drug, can improve the intravesical treatment of drug perfusion efficient, increase drug effect in time of bladder and continue to keep the intravesical drug level.
Technical scheme of the present invention is: a kind of bladder drainage drug infusion device, comprise the catheter that is provided with the location capsule, and said catheter is three lumens that are provided with the drainage lumens of urinating, water-injecting cavity, drug infusion chamber; Three chambeies of this catheter are independent separately, and the said drainage lumens of urinating is positioned at the catheter center, the upper end closed of said catheter; The sidewall of catheter upper end is provided with draining hole and communicates with the drainage lumens of urinating; The outlet that the catheter lower end surface is provided with the drainage lumens of urinating is communicated with urinary drainage bag, and said water-injecting cavity, drug infusion chamber are located at respectively in the catheter sidewall, and the water filling port of water-injecting cavity upper end communicates with the location capsule; The water injection hole of water-injecting cavity lower end connects the water filling interface; The water filling interface is provided with switch, and the medicine-pouring port of upper end, said drug infusion chamber runs through the catheter sidewall, and the medicine-pouring hole of lower end, drug infusion chamber connects the injection interface; Said injection interface is connected with the drug infusion pump of a scalable flow velocity through conduit, and an end of said drug infusion pump is connected with medicament canister.
Said water-injecting cavity and drug infusion chamber lay respectively at the drainage lumens both sides of urinating.
The internal diameter in said water-injecting cavity and drug infusion chamber is all less than the internal diameter of the drainage lumens of urinating.
Said water filling port is positioned at the below of draining hole, and the distance of this water filling port end face apart from the catheter upper end is greater than the distance of draining hole apart from catheter upper end end face.
Said medicine-pouring port is between draining hole and catheter upper end end face.
Said water injection hole and medicine-pouring hole are screwed hole, and said water filling interface and injection interface are threaded with water injection hole and medicine-pouring hole respectively.
Adopt technique scheme: with catheter upper end insertion patient's intravesical, it is external that the lower end is retained in the patient, and the location capsule together inserts patient's intravesical with the upper end of catheter; Because said catheter is three lumens that are provided with the drainage lumens of urinating, water-injecting cavity, drug infusion chamber; Three chambeies of this catheter are independent separately, make catheter when realizing urethral catheterization, carry out dabbling drug; And independent separately, can not interfere.Because the said drainage lumens of urinating is positioned at the catheter center; And the upper end closed of catheter; The sidewall of catheter upper end is provided with draining hole and communicates with the drainage lumens of urinating, and the outlet that the catheter lower end surface is provided with the drainage lumens of urinating is communicated with urinary drainage bag, makes the intravesical urine of patient can be in draining hole flows into the drainage lumens of urinating of catheter like this; Be discharged in the urinary drainage bag through the drainage lumens of urinating again, realized the function of urethral catheterization.Because said water-injecting cavity, drug infusion chamber are located at respectively in the catheter sidewall, wherein the water filling port of water-injecting cavity upper end communicates with the location capsule, and the water injection hole of water-injecting cavity lower end connects the water filling interface; The water filling interface is provided with switch, during use, opens the switch on the water filling interface; Through water-injecting cavity water filling in the capsule of location, the location capsule is heaved, when being close to opening of bladder, the location capsule after heaving can close switch; Stop water filling; Thereby make the location capsule after heaving both can play the effect of sealing opening of bladder, can locate catheter again, also can not cause sense of discomfort the patient; The medicine-pouring port of upper end, said drug infusion chamber runs through the catheter sidewall, and the medicine-pouring hole of lower end, drug infusion chamber connects the injection interface, and said injection interface is connected with the drug infusion pump of a scalable flow velocity through conduit; One end of said drug infusion pump is connected with medicament canister, and the medicine in the medicament canister can be flowed into earlier in the drug infusion pump, regulates and controls well behind the flow velocity through the drug infusion pump; Continue to be fed into patient's intravesical slowly through the drug infusion chamber again, thereby make patient's intravesical can keep two fun gi polysaccharides for a long time, no matter whether emptying of patient's bladder; Drug level can remain unchanged basically, compares with existing method for filling, and this device has not only increased the time of drug effect in bladder; Make the patient can accept the Drug therapy of longer time; Improve curative effect, avoided drug waste, and reduced the concentration of dabbling drug; Avoided bladder being caused stimulation, improved the safety of drug infusion because of the excessive concentration of dabbling drug.
Because said water injection hole and medicine-pouring hole are screwed hole, said water filling interface and injection interface are threaded with water injection hole and medicine-pouring hole respectively, are convenient to mounting or dismounting, and is easy to use.
This bladder drainage drug infusion device; Simple in structure, easy to use, both had the urethral catheterization function; Can continue as required again slowly to the intravesical dabbling drug; Effectively raise the efficient of intravesical treatment of drug perfusion, increased drug effect in time of bladder and continue to have kept the intravesical drug level, guaranteed therapeutic effect.
